  • For those that don't like roguelikes/roguelites, what are your issues with them from a design perspective?
    For me, one of the best roguelites is Nuclear Throne. They have permadeath, they have procedural levels, the have difficulty peaks but all is set correctly. All the progress come on the skills. We, as a player, sense that we are better and better to beat the game and reach the throne. Source: about 3 years ago
